MoU signed between Dholera Industrial City and Airbus

Gandhinagar: The 60-strong high-profile French delegation, led by French Embassy Minister Counsellor Jean-Marc Fennet, looked forward to investing in energy, transportation, regional airways, energy from wastes and other sectors, to strengthen the Indo-French Agreement of 1998.

Speaking at the French Country Seminar jointly organized by Embassy and FICC at the eighth biennial Vibrant Gujarat Global Summit (VGGS-2017) at Mahatma Madir here, Mr. Fennet said that truly vibrant and dynamic Gujarat offers great scope for investment as per the outlook of the representatives of industrial and business houses from France. They are keen to partner Gujarat in the latter’s economic development.

FICCI Gujarat State Council Chairperson Rajiv Vastupal said that FICCI has very strong relations. He exuded confidence that Gujarat’s business and industry friendly policies would facilitate investment and economic growth.

Gujarat side was represented by Principal Secretary for Energy Sujit Kumar Gulati. The MoUs for Dholera Industrial City and Airbus were signed by Gujarat Maritime Board (GMB) CEO and MD Ajay Bhadoo.
